Transaction 518ba5113347ed288948accd40784d8c06500eac6d0844207ccffd39455fffbb
1 Input
2 Outputs
- 518ba5113347ed288948accd40784d8c06500eac6d0844207ccffd39455fffbb:0
- 518ba5113347ed288948accd40784d8c06500eac6d0844207ccffd39455fffbb:1
value 1647450
address 3FZxgHGeBNSY1Y3xWofcZTZbJYT7EyvysX
value 30059597
address 1BwGUtHirPQ4dKusbCTcxMbxBTu24yRkHa